Nigerian youths have besieged the Nnamdi Azikiwe International Airport in Abuja to welcome to the presidential candidate of the Labour Party (LP), Peter Obi from his three-day study tour of Egypt.
KanyiDaily recalls that the Anambra former governor had on Tuesday announced his three-day visit to the north-eastern African country to understudy its power, education, planning, and finance sectors.
On Thursday, Obi’s media aide, Valentine Obienyem, took to his Facebook page and shared photos of the presidential candidate visiting the New Capital Power Plant in New Cairo, Egypt.
In the photos, Peter Obi was seen with engineers at the power plant in Egypt learning how the country increased its power generation to become one of the biggest in Africa.
The presidential candidate returned to Nigeria on Saturday and was ambushed by a large number of youths who wanted to take pictures with the Onitsha-born politician.
